Understanding the Importance of the Starting Pitcher
The starting pitcher plays a pivotal role in a baseball game. They set the tone for the team and are responsible for getting through the first few innings, ideally while keeping the opponent's score low. A strong starting pitcher can give their team a significant advantage and boost their chances of winning.
Here's why the starting pitcher is so important:
- Setting the Pace: The starting pitcher dictates the tempo of the game. A pitcher who throws strikes and gets ahead in the count can control the game and put pressure on the opposing hitters.
- Going Deep into the Game: A quality start, typically defined as pitching at least six innings and allowing three or fewer earned runs, is crucial for a team's success. It saves the bullpen from overuse and gives the team a better chance to win.
- Matchups: Teams often strategize based on pitching matchups. A left-handed pitcher might be favored against a lineup heavy with left-handed hitters, and vice versa. Understanding these matchups can add another layer of excitement to watching the game.

How Pitching Rotations Work
In baseball, teams use a pitching rotation to ensure that their starting pitchers get adequate rest between starts. A typical rotation consists of five pitchers, with each pitcher starting approximately every fifth day. This allows pitchers to recover physically and mentally, maximizing their performance and reducing the risk of injury.
Here's a simplified explanation of how a pitching rotation works:
- Pitcher A starts the first game.
- Pitcher B starts the second game.
- Pitcher C starts the third game.
- Pitcher D starts the fourth game.
- Pitcher E starts the fifth game.
- The rotation then cycles back to Pitcher A, who starts the sixth game, and so on.
Of course, this is a simplified model. Teams may adjust their rotation due to off days, injuries, or strategic considerations. However, the basic principle remains the same: to provide pitchers with sufficient rest and maintain a consistent starting pitching schedule.
Factors Affecting Pitching Decisions
Many factors go into the manager's decision of who will pitch on a given day. These factors can include:
- Pitcher Performance: A pitcher's recent performance is a major factor. If a pitcher has been struggling, the manager may give them extra rest or adjust their role.
- Matchups: As mentioned earlier, matchups between pitchers and hitters can influence pitching decisions. Managers may try to exploit favorable matchups and avoid unfavorable ones.
- Opponent's Lineup: The composition of the opposing team's lineup can also play a role. A team with many left-handed hitters may face a different starting pitcher than a team with mostly right-handed hitters.
- Fatigue and Rest: Pitchers need adequate rest to perform at their best. Managers must balance the desire to win with the need to protect their pitchers' health.
- Injuries: Injuries can significantly impact pitching decisions. If a pitcher is injured, the team will need to make adjustments to their rotation.
